As of 01/11/09, apparently, McAfee got new definitions that blocked a2uploader from working on my PC. As of 01/14/09, McAfee got newer dfeinitions that caused a2uploader to be deleted from my PC.![]()
Unfortunately, I am using a coprorate laptop and the DAT files are pushed to my PC by corporate eSecurity group. Even if I modify McAfee to allow a2uploader to keep working, within 5 minutes, Corp blows away my changes and a2uploader is gone again.![]()
I will have to get my old (very old) laptop up and running again if I want to continue using a2uploader or maybe move over to my media center PC, which I don't really want to do.
The point here is that it may be your antivirus/spyware app that is causing a2uploader to not detect your phone. You may want to go into what ever app you're using and add a2uploader to the exceptions list(s) so that it does not get blocked, quarantined, etc.. Of course, if you chose to do this, you do so at your own risk, and I will not be held responsible if you have a perverted copy of a2uploader that has an actual virus/spyware/malware in it.
